    Almost back to normal... We have had snow, but now melted and grass doesn't seem to have suffered. I'm starting to replace Christmas red head collars with everyday ones. Keeping fingers crossed for Gandalf about the 10th but that depends on another "clear" TB test for my friends cattle (first week of January).

    In laws here still but gone tomorrow, then I have to hit the books as Tax Return due in January....

    Frodo I have decided not to remove his antlers as even though he hasn't dropped them, he isn't the slightest bit "rutty" so I am mingling with him with no problem. He's still just with Elsa as I am thinking of giving Boris another shot of testosterone to try to get him to shed his antlers and that may make him a little too "playful" for Frodo... Still unsure yet - I would have jabbed Boris a couple of weeks ago but his coat hasn't been dry with snow/rain... Reindeer are prone to abscesses, so can't risk jabs on wet coats.
